Abstract
An enterostomy device for providing fluids and nutrients through a stoma formed through the abdominal wall of a patient is described. The enterostomy device, which may be configured as either a gastrostomy device or a jejunostomy device, comprises a low-profile retaining member which is configured to be unobtrusively positioned within the stomach or the intestine, and which is configured to provide sufficient surface area for contacting the stomach or intestine to prevent unintentional removal or release of the enterostomy device from the patient. The enterostomy device is also structured with a low-profile port hub for facilitating the inflation of the retaining member and feeding and venting through the stoma.

15. A method of delivering fluids to the stomach of a patient through a stoma formed through the abdominal wall of the patient, comprising:
-
providing a gastrostomy device having a stoma tube, a port hub, an inflation line and a retaining member comprised of an inflatable ring extending and spaced apart from said stoma tube, said retaining member being initially housed within said stoma tube for deployment;
positioning said stoma tube of said gastrostomy device through an existing stoma formed through the abdominal wall of the patient;
injecting a fluid through said inflation line to initiate ejection of said retaining member from said stoma tube; and
inflating said inflatable ring with said fluid until said inflatable ring is spaced apart from the stoma tube and is in contact with the lining of the patient'"'"'s stomach.

18. A method of delivering fluids to the intestine of a patient through a stoma formed through the abdominal wall of the patient, comprising:
-
providing a jejunostomy device having a stoma tube, a port hub, an inflation line, a retaining member comprised of an inflatable ring extending and spaced apart from said stoma tube and a jejunostomy tube extending from said stoma tube, said retaining member and jejunostomy being initially housed within said stoma tube for deployment;
positioning said stoma tube of said jejunostomy device through an existing stoma formed through the abdominal wall of the patient into the intestine;
injecting a fluid through said inflation line to initiate ejection of said retaining member from said stoma tube;
inflating said inflatable ring with said fluid until said inflatable ring is spaced apart from the stoma tube and is in contact with the lining of the intestine; and
injecting a bolus of fluid through a port in said port hub and into said stoma tube to eject said jejunostomy tube from said stoma tube.
